Product Description
Jet JT PT2748A-082A shaft is a factory replacement wheel axle for Jet PTW-2748A and PTW-2748B manual pallet jacks. Constructed from hardened SAE 1045 carbon steel with industrial black oxide finish, this shaft fits main load roller assemblies and is retained by snap rings and spring pins. Compatible with 51109 thrust bearings and designed for precision fit within Jet 27 x 48 inch fork pallet truck frame assemblies.

Q: What material is the JT PT2748A-082A shaft made from?
A: This shaft is constructed from hardened SAE 1045 carbon steel with an industrial black oxide finish. The hardening process increases wear resistance and load capacity, while the oxide coating provides corrosion protection in wet or humid warehouse environments.
Q: What bearing type does this shaft accommodate?
A: The JT PT2748A-082A is engineered for precision fit with 51109 thrust bearings. These bearings handle axial loads while maintaining smooth rotation of the load roller assembly.
Q: How is this shaft retained in the frame assembly?
A: The shaft is retained by snap rings and spring pins at each end. These fasteners prevent axial movement and keep the shaft centered within the load roller assembly during operation.
Q: What is the expected service life of this SAE 1045 shaft?
A: A properly maintained SAE 1045 carbon steel shaft typically delivers 5-7 years of service in normal warehouse duty cycles. Shafts showing scoring, corrosion, or loss of bearing preload should be replaced to prevent load roller drift and uneven weight distribution.
